Immune privilege extended to allogeneic tumor cells in the vitreous cavity.

Abstract

Inoculation of alloantigenic P815 tumor cells into the vitreous cavity of eyes of BALB/c mice resulted in the intraocular development of progressively growing tumors. We observed by clinical and histologic examination that the tumors acquired a blood supply, lacked significant necrosis or degeneration, and gradually penetrated the globe into the orbit. Mice bearing these intraocular tumors did not develop tumor-specific delayed hypersensitivity (DH), and their spleens contained lymphocytes capable of suppressing tumor-specific DH when transferred adoptively into naive, syngeneic recipients. The authors conclude that the vitreous cavity (VC) is an immunologically privileged site for histoincompatible tumor cells and that the privilege is mediated by active suppression of DH, similar to anterior chamber (AC)-associated, immune deviation.

摘要

将同种异体抗原性P815肿瘤细胞接种到BALB/c小鼠眼的玻璃体腔中,导致眼内逐渐生长的肿瘤的形成。通过临床和组织学检查,我们观察到肿瘤获得了血液供应,没有明显的坏死或退变,并逐渐穿透眼球进入眼眶。携带这些眼内肿瘤的小鼠未发生肿瘤特异性迟发型超敏反应(DH),并且它们的脾脏含有淋巴细胞,当将其过继转移到同基因的未致敏受体中时,这些淋巴细胞能够抑制肿瘤特异性DH。作者得出结论,玻璃体腔(VC)是组织不相容肿瘤细胞的免疫赦免部位,并且这种赦免是由对DH的主动抑制介导的,类似于前房(AC)相关的免疫偏离。
